Two people were seriously injured after a motorcycle crash on State Route 332 near State Route 96.
Troopers say that two people were on a motorcycle, headed north, when it collided with an SUV shortly before 8 pm.
One was airlifted to Strong Memorial Hospital via Mercy Flight, while the second was transported with serious injuries.
The driver of the SUV was even injured, and according to police, that individual suffered a broken arm as result of the wreck.
The investigation is continuing, but Troopers said that it appeared as though the SUV pulled out of a gas station — when the accident happened.
